Why "VF Chapitre 1"?
The "VF" part stands for "Version Française," which is, you know, French version. And "Chapitre 1" refers to Chapter 1. Simple enough, right? Well, not always. You'd be surprised how many sites claim to have "VF Chapitre 1," only to deliver a grainy, barely legible scan in Spanish. Or worse, a Rickroll. (Don't think I haven't been there. I'm looking at you, internet pranksters.)

But why "telecharger" (download)? Well, back in the day, downloading was the only way to read manga online. Streaming wasn't really a thing, so you had to snag the images and view them on your computer. Even today, some people prefer to download the scans for offline reading.
